Rose Backroad Force AXS vs Specialized Diverge 4 Comp Carbon - SRAM Apex AXS/S1000
Both are gravel bikes at a similar price. Here is what actually separates them.
The short answer
For a typical all-round rider the Specialized Diverge 4 Comp Carbon - SRAM Apex AXS/S1000 comes out ahead (69% against 67%). That is not a universal verdict — change the terrain or the priority and the order can flip.
What actually separates them
- Price
- The Rose Backroad Force AXS is £99 cheaper — £3,700 against £3,799.
- Weight
- The Rose Backroad Force AXS is 0.6kg lighter, which you notice on long climbs more than anywhere else.
- Riding position
- The Specialized Diverge 4 Comp Carbon - SRAM Apex AXS/S1000 sits you more upright (1.52 stack-to-reach against 1.47). The Rose Backroad Force AXS is the more aggressive of the two — quicker if you can hold it, harder work if you cannot.
- Tyre clearance
- The Rose Backroad Force AXS takes 53mm tyres against 50mm — the single most common thing buyers wish they had more of.
- Climbing gear
- The Specialized Diverge 4 Comp Carbon - SRAM Apex AXS/S1000 has the easier bottom gear (21 gear inches against 23), which matters more than weight on anything genuinely steep.
- Mudguards
- Only the Specialized Diverge 4 Comp Carbon - SRAM Apex AXS/S1000 takes mudguards, which decides whether it can be your winter bike.
Side by side
| Spec | Backroad Force AXS | Diverge 4 Comp Carbon - SRAM Apex AXS/S1000 |
|---|---|---|
| Price | £3,700 | £3,799 |
| Weight | 9.1 kg | 9.7 kg |
| Frame | carbon | carbon |
| Groupset | SRAM Force XPLR AXS 1x13 electronic | SRAM Apex AXS with S1000 Eagle 1x12 electronic |
| Stack / reach | 1.47 | 1.52 |
| Tyre clearance | 53 mm | 50 mm |
| Lowest gear | 23 in | 21 in |
| Mudguard mounts | No | Yes |
